First-in-europe Cancer Equipment Officially Opened By Lady Elsie Robson
Today (Wednesday 12th September) Lady Elsie Robson officially opened the Sir Bobby Robson Foundation PET Tracer Production Unit at Newcastle University.
The cutting-edge facility will make a significant difference to people fighting cancer in the north east and Cumbria as well as international efforts to find more effective treatments for the disease.

Marathon Football Attempt Beaten By The Weather
A valiant attempt to play a 24 hour football match to raise funds for the Sir Bobby Robson Foundation ended earlier than planned due to appalling weather conditions.
Match officials were forced to call the game off after 13 hours play on safety grounds, much to the disappointment of players.
